A little bit of early morning haze around the hills but it looks like another warm and bright day ahead in Foxford. The river is at 0.45m at Ballylahan bridge. Up to yesterday it was still carrying peat stained water from last weekends flood. This will clear in the coming days which will help. Very quiet on the river yesterday with only a few anglers venturing out, not surprising. The next few days will be difficult, mainly due to the bright weather. Early morning and late evening will be the best times.
